Urine Alcohol Testing

Urine alcohol testing identifies alcohol consumption through the presence of ethanol and its metabolites in urine. This test is a reliable method used to detect alcohol usage typically within the past 80 hours. Its effectiveness makes it a preferred choice for various needs including legal and workplace requirements.

Hair Alcohol Testing

Hair alcohol testing provides a detailed history of alcohol consumption over an extended period. By analyzing hair samples, this method offers insights into long-term drinking habits, often spanning months. It is beneficial in legal and clinical settings where an overview of an individual’s alcohol use is required.

ETG/ETS Alcohol Testing

ETG/ETS alcohol testing detects ethyl glucuronide and ethyl sulfate, metabolites indicating alcohol consumption. This method, popular in Pooler, Georgia, is effective for determining recent alcohol use even after the alcohol itself has cleared, making it ideal for monitoring sobriety in various settings.

Alcohol Statistics for Pooler, Georgia

Currently, specific alcohol abuse statistics focusing solely on Pooler, Georgia, are not readily available. However, general state-level data may provide some insights into trends affecting the area. For instance, in the state of Georgia, alcohol is the most commonly abused substance, with significant numbers of individuals seeking treatment for alcohol-related disorders.

According to Georgia's Department of Behavioral Health and Developmental Disabilities, over 20% of individuals admitted to treatment programs cited alcohol as their primary substance of abuse. Additionally, binge drinking rates have been a public health concern across the state, impacting various communities, including Pooler.

Efforts to combat alcohol abuse in Georgia include educational programs and initiatives aimed at reducing consumption and increasing awareness of the related harms. These statewide efforts are supported by local programs and community actions aimed at promoting healthier lifestyles and preventing alcohol abuse.

Accredited Drug Testing provides breath alcohol testing with evidential devices, saliva/oral fluid alcohol screening, post-accident and reasonable suspicion testing, and ongoing/random alcohol monitoring programs. Breath alcohol testing is commonly used for both DOT and non-DOT workplace compliance because it can document an exact alcohol concentration.
Alcohol testing is frequently required after a workplace accident, when there is reasonable suspicion of on-duty impairment, before an employee returns to duty after an alcohol policy violation, as part of random testing pools for regulated safety-sensitive positions, and for court, probation, or program compliance.
Breath alcohol testing can generate an immediate reading of alcohol concentration and, in the case of evidential breath testing, produce a documented result that can be used to support policy action or regulatory compliance. Saliva screening can also provide rapid indication of alcohol presence.
Yes. An individual can schedule an alcohol test directly for personal reasons, legal documentation, or family-related concerns. A doctor's order is not required to request testing.
Yes. Accredited Drug Testing supports urgent post-accident and reasonable suspicion alcohol testing because those situations often require immediate documentation of whether alcohol was a factor in a workplace incident or observed behavior.
Yes. Accredited Drug Testing provides evidential breath alcohol testing using certified devices and trained technicians in alignment with DOT requirements for safety-sensitive employees. This supports compliance needs such as post-accident, reasonable suspicion, random, return-to-duty, and follow-up testing.
Results are released only to the authorized party, which may include an employer's designated representative for workplace testing, a probation or court contact for compliance testing, or the individual who ordered the test. All results are handled confidentially.
Yes. Alcohol testing can be performed on-site at a workplace or job location. Mobile testing helps employers document impairment concerns immediately, reduce downtime, and meet regulatory response timelines after an incident.
